Overview
Focused Care at Summer Place, located in Beaumont, Texas, is a facility that provides various levels of care including rehabilitation and hospice services. While some reviews highlight the dedication of certain staff members and the cleanliness of the facility, others raise significant concerns about the quality of care and communication.
Services & Support
The facility offers rehabilitation, hospice care, and memory care services. Residents have access to a variety of activities, which some families appreciate, noting that the activities team is engaged and creative in providing entertainment for residents. However, there are mixed reviews regarding the overall support and responsiveness of the staff.
Care Approach & Staff
While some reviews commend the staff for their caring and knowledgeable approach, others report experiences of neglect and unprofessionalism. Instances of residents waiting long periods for assistance after using call lights have been noted, raising concerns about staff availability and attentiveness. Positive feedback highlights the passion of certain staff members, particularly in the rehabilitation department, but there are also reports of dismissive attitudes from some staff when families seek information about their loved ones’ care.

Living Options & Amenities
The facility is described as clean and well-maintained, with a pleasant atmosphere. Residents have opportunities to participate in both in-house and community activities, which can enhance their quality of life. However, some reviews suggest that privacy and dignity issues have arisen due to open room doors and visible patient information.
Dining & Activities
Dining experiences reported by families have been inconsistent, with some noting that food is served cold and lacking in proper condiments. However, there are also positive mentions of the food’s taste and appearance from some residents. Activities provided at the facility are generally well-received, with residents enjoying the variety offered.
